#rant I’m a nurse case manager. I grew up in a single payer country, but now work in the USA. The health insurance system hurts me in my soul.

I have a patient that’s on a $1200 a month disability pension. They take $200 a month for premiums. I want to discharge her on eliquis. The pharmacy called and said it would be just shy of $500 for a starter pack. It’s probably her deductible. But she’s not going to pay it. If I can’t find a way to get it she will go home without the AC she needs. Also because it’s a managed Medicare plan the pharmacy can’t apply coupons. This system makes me sick.
